Market Anomaly Testing: Phenomena of Day of the Week Effect and Month of the Year Effect on IDX80 in Indonesia Stock Exchange Fransiska Shasa Yolanda; Maria Theresia Ernawati; Caecilia Wahyu Estining Rahayu

Abstract

This study aims at determining occurrence of day of the week effect, Monday effect, weekend effect, month of the year effect, and January effect on IDX80 stock trading in the Indonesia Stock Exchange. This is an empirical study on trading time (daily and monthly) and stock returns using comparative method. The population is companies incorporated in the IDX80 index on the Indonesia Stock Exchange. Applying purposive sampling method, the sample was 70 companies consistently listed in the IDX80 index and were actively trading. The data covering daily and monthly stock returns for the period 1 February 2019 - 31 January 2020 were analyzed using Kruskal Wallis and Mann Whitney U Test/Wilcoxon Sum Rank Test. The results show that during the study period, market anomalies occurred in the Indonesian Capital Market were the day of the week effect, Monday effect, and month of the year effect. While market anomalies that haven’t been proven to occur in the Indonesian Capital Market were the weekend effect and the January effect.
The Effect of Financial Performance on Stock Prices: Empirical Evidence from Building Construction Sub-Sector Companies: Article Christina Heti Tri Rahmawati; Sri Hartuti; Maria Theresia Ernawati

Abstract

The company's financial performance is an assessment of the financial condition of investors when they invest their capital. The purpose of this study is to measure the effect of financial performance using liquidity, profitability and solvency ratios on stock prices of building construction sub-sector companies listed on the Indonesia Stock Exchange for the period 2014-2020 either simultaneously or partially. This study has a population of 18 companies listed in the building construction sub-sector on the IDX. This study uses a sampling technique, namely purposive sampling, where the sampling criteria are in the form of an annual report and have data on stock market prices continuously during the study period. study uses data analysis techniques in the form of multiple linear regression analysis with SPSS Version 25 applicationThe implication of the results of this study for investors should look at the company's solvency ratio before making a stock purchase, so that the greater the solvency ratio can increase the company's stock price.
Analisis Peranan Jaringan Sosial pada Pembentukan dan Pemeliharaan Pengelolaan BUMDes yang Demokratis (Studi Kasus: BUMDes Tunas Mandiri, Desa Nglanggeran, Kecamatan Patuk, Kabupaten Gunung Kidul) L Bambang Harnoto; Prismanto Atmaji; Yuliana Rini Hardanti; Maria Theresia Ernawati

Abstract

Social networks as the essence of social capital theory have a significant, strategic, and central role in the formation and maintenance of democratic BUMDes governance. This study aims to describe the role of social networks in the formation and maintenance of democratic BUMDes management. This type of research is a case study using descriptive analysis through tables and graphs. The population of this research is all members of BUMDes Tunas Mandiri. The number of samples in this study were 100 respondents. The research sample selection technique used is purposive sampling. Data were collected by using a questionnaire that had been tested for its validity and reliability. The results of this study indicate that social networks supported by a strong local culture have a significant and central role in the formation and maintenance of democratic BUMDes governance. A strong social network will also provide benefits for BUMDes governance that leads to the resolution of financial/economic and managerial issues.
